Job summary

Emerson is offering an internship in engineering focused on manufacturing processes and continuous improvement. You will work on production tooling, process design, and cost reduction activities, collaborating with multiple teams across the organization.

Ideal candidates are pursuing an engineering degree, have strong communication skills, and are legally eligible to work in the United States. The role is in-person, full-time, with a competitive hourly pay rate and supportive internship program.

Qualifications

  • Pursuing a bachelor’s in engineering.
  • Zero (0) years of related experience.
  • Ability to work full-time (40 hours) per week in-person.
  • Legal authorization to work in the United States.

Responsibilities

  • Apply technical expertise in the production of products.
  • Select, design or recommend tools, fixtures, and equipment.
  • Develop manufacturing processes and procedures to reduce problems and costs.
  • Recommend design changes to increase quality or reduce problems and costs.
  • Solve production problems and improve process capabilities.
  • Participate in the presentation of test results and design reviews.
  • Interact with other functional groups, vendors, or customers.
  • Participate in the administration of technical procedures.
  • Initiate and implement routine engineering change authorizations.
  • Support capacity model and lean initiatives. May participate in lean six sigma improvement teams.
  • May interact with teammates in numerous global locations
